Output 8091bbc18bd37231bdeb7cc847694c4b7f88c773e168af7c17f4b8e4e6363d82:21

value
41756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64ccd849b98d7b392c23afc09780669e295b445b OP_EQUAL
address
3AsztbegoghkDtzoMUGgpcGJgSWKKoWnE9
transaction
8091bbc18bd37231bdeb7cc847694c4b7f88c773e168af7c17f4b8e4e6363d82